Abstract :
A new method to design matching networks for multistage microwave amplifiers in a prescribed frequency band with requirements about the transducer gain flatness is presented. A topology of matching network is obtained firstly according to the criteria of minimum network Q values in the centre frequency. Then the transducer gain function is got using the harmonic balance. And the best transducer gain can be obtained by optimizing the matching networks
